Your Opportunity:
The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) is a regulated member of the inter-professional health care team who utilizes the nursing process, critical thinking, problem solving and decision-making skills to provide care to individuals across the life span. The LPN provides care in alignment with Alberta Health Services mission to provide patient focused quality health services and the AHS values of respect, accountability, transparency, engagement, safety, learning, and performance. This is a dynamic position that requires accurate multi-tasking and priority setting in order to accomplish daily goals. The LPN's practice encompasses the application of nursing knowledge, skills and judgment to assess patient needs and provides nursing care, which is reflective of their level of education and knowledge. The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) works in a fast-paced Clinic. This posting is for an LPN to work within our Neuroscience department at the Kaye Edmonton Clinic.
Description:
As a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), you are part of an interprofessional health care team utilizing nursing processes, critical thinking, problem solving and decision making skills. You will be guided by your education, experience, demonstrated skill level and AHS policies and procedures. You will play a key role in providing safe, quality patient and family centered care while reflecting the shared vision and values of AHS.

Required Qualifications:
Completion of an accredited practical nurse education program. Active or eligible for registration and practice permit with the College of Licensed Practical Nurses of Alberta (CLPNA). Current Basic Cardiac Life Support - Health Care Provider (BCLS-HCP).
Additional Required Qualifications:
Relevant experience with adult population (Neurosciences, Acute Care, Ambulatory Care) as an LPN. BLS Certified. Demonstrated excellent assessment, documentation, clinical, organizational and patient care skills. Able to effectively maintain collaborative working relationships in a multidisciplinary environment. Must be able to demonstrate excellent communication and multitasking skills. Knowledge and ability to use computer applications such as Microsoft Office, Excel, and Outlook is required. Ability to push, pull, and lift equipment of up to 40 lbs. Must be able to participate in patient care including assessments, moving and handling, transfers and mobility support. Must be able to sit and stand for prolonged periods, bend and twist and be able to perform repetitive computer tasks.
Preferred Qualifications:
Proficiency with Connect Care preferred. Experience as an LPN in an ambulatory environment, 1 years' experience with neuroscience population (Parkinsons, Stroke, MS, Neuromuscular conditions etc) preferred
